ALKEN (HENRY)
Qualified Horses and Unqualified Riders, or the Reverse of Sporting Phrases Taken from the Work Entitled Indispensible Accomplishments, S. and J. Fuller, 1815 [watermarked "J. Whatman, 1864"]
Qualified Horses and Unqualified Riders, or the Reverse of Sporting Phrases Taken from the Work Entitled Indispensible Accomplishments, engraved title-page, 7 hand-coloured etched plates, contemporary red half morocco gilt, titled in gilt on spine, t.e.g. [Tooley 44; Schwerdt I, p.20], oblong folio (285 x 382mm.), S. and J. Fuller, 1815 [watermarked "J. Whatman, 1864"]
"A humorous set depicting hunting accidents drawn in vigorous sytle" (Schwerdt).
